What is Redondear a las centésimas?

Redondear a las centésimas is a mathematical concept that involves rounding off a number to the nearest hundredth. When we round off a number, we are changing it to a value that is easier to work with. For example, if we have the number 3.789, we can round it off to 3.79, which is the nearest hundredth.

Why is Redondear a las centésimas important?

Redondear a las centésimas is important because it allows us to work with numbers that are easier to manage. For example, if we are dealing with money, we may want to round off our numbers to the nearest hundredth to avoid dealing with fractions of a penny. Similarly, in science, we may want to round off our measurements to the nearest hundredth to reduce measurement errors.
